Headword: *siti/sewn
Adler number: sigma,496
Translated headword: of provisions
Vetting Status: high
Translation:
[Meaning] of foods, of expenses.
Greek Original:
*siti/sewn: trofw=n, dapanw=n.
Note:
= Synagoge sigma93; also Photius, Lexicon sigma246, where however Theodoridis obelizes siti/sewn, the transmitted form of the genitive plural headword (otherwise unattested), and declares correct the orthodox and common spelling sith/sewn, as in Suda mss AGVM. Either way, evidently quoted from somewhere; extant possibilities are all from late antiquity.
